AI summary of reviews

Practical language, frameworks and safety-planning tools give attendees confidence to ask direct questions about suicide and support children and young people. They describe knowledgeable, compassionate trainers who make a difficult subject feel safe, manageable and stigma-free through clear explanations, real-life examples, discussion and occasional role play. Well-structured sessions offer a comfortable pace, reflection and useful workbooks and resources, with learning readily applied in professional practice.
